Head of Infrastructure - Scotland or Manchester / Hybrid 

Permanent plus excellent package

Overview:

Opportunity for a Head of IT Infrastructure to join our Core IT Team. This is a great opportunity to develop your professional career within our rapidly expanding global business.

The role requires an experienced, hands-on IT Infrastructure leader managing a team of infrastructure and security engineering resources responsible for designing, building, deploying, maintaining, securing, and supporting IT infrastructure across end user compute, data centre, server and network estates. 

What are we looking for ?

This role will require a strong operational focus and leadership skills, and a deep commitment to end-user satisfaction and experience in driving IT infrastructure improvement. In parellel the right person will have several years leading an IT Infrastructure team, with exposure to the Microsoft stack including O365/M365 in an environment of similar size and complexity.

 In terms of specific technologies, experience in the following would be beneficial:

  • Experience with Windows Server 2003 – 2019
  • Storage (SAN/NAS) – NetApp, IBM Storwize, QNAP
  • Virtualisation – VMWare vSphere 5.5 – 7.0
  • Microsoft Azure – IaaS, PaaS
  • Identity – Active Directory; AzureAD
  • Microsoft Exchange 2013 – 2019
  • Windows 7 / Windows 10
  • LAN/WAN – Cisco Networking
  • Endpoint Management – MS Endpoint Manager (Intune)

This is a very exciting opportunity and entails the following; 

  • This role will be leading the Core IT Infrastructure team providing development and advice, ensuring it operates effectively in a changing/developing Core IT infrastructure landscape
  • Ensure IT is capable of meeting business needs via secure, stable, highly available IT infrastructure; delivered through effective BAU fix/fulfilment, execution of continuous improvement plans and project resourcing
  • Leveraging industry best practices, frameworks, and product expertise / knowledge to continuously improve the operation and functionality of  Core IT infrastructure portfolio
  • Establishing Core IT infrastructure performance through metrics, stakeholder engagement and transactional feedback; developing action plans to address areas needing improvement
  • Ensuring Core IT infrastructure remains within operational standards and governance regarding currency, security, licencing and budget
  • Maintaining knowledge of IT infrastructure technology, including the Microsoft stack, and industry trends
  • Participate in both IT infrastructure and IT security council meetings
